🎵 Journey – “Don’t Stop Believin'” (1981) 🎹🎸🎤✨

Some songs lift spirits, but this one became an anthem. From its first piano notes to its powerful final chorus, Don’t Stop Believin’ has inspired generations.

No matter the decade, its message of hope still shines.

  • Writers: Steve Perry, Jonathan Cain, Neal Schon
  • Album: Escape (1981)
  • Producer: Kevin Elson and Mike Stone

“Don’t Stop Believin'” was written by Steve Perry (vocals), Jonathan Cain (keyboards), and Neal Schon (guitar) for Journey’s seventh studio album, Escape, released in 1981.

Although it was initially a modest hit upon its release, peaking at #9 on the Billboard Hot 100, the song has since become one of the most iconic and enduring anthems in rock history.

The song originated from Jonathan Cain’s personal struggles before joining Journey.

He had moved to Los Angeles to pursue his music career, but after facing repeated failures, he considered giving up.

His father encouraged him to keep going, often saying, “Don’t stop believin’, son.”

These words of encouragement became the foundation for the song’s now-iconic chorus.

  • Iconic Keyboard Intro: Jonathan Cain’s piano riff is one of the most recognizable intros in rock history.
  • Layered Build-Up: The song builds gradually, adding instruments and vocal harmonies, creating a crescendo leading to the final chorus.
  • Steve Perry’s Vocals: His soaring, emotional voice delivers the song’s hopeful message with unmatched sincerity.
  • Neal Schon’s Guitar Solo: A brief yet powerful guitar solo adds emotional weight to the song.
  • Unique Song Structure: The famous chorus doesn’t appear until the very end, an unconventional choice that makes its arrival feel triumphant.
  • “Don’t Stop Believin'” became one of Journey’s signature songs and one of the best-selling digital tracks of all time.
  • The song was famously featured in the final scene of HBO’s The Sopranos, leaving fans debating the ending for years.
  • It gained renewed popularity when it was performed by the cast of Glee (2009), introducing the song to a new generation.
  • “Don’t Stop Believin'” has become a stadium anthem, frequently played at sports events, concerts, and celebrations.
  • The song symbolizes resilience, triumph, and unwavering hope, transcending generations and cultures.
  • Jonathan Cain kept a notebook filled with inspirational sayings from his father, and “Don’t stop believin'” was among them.
  • The song’s chorus doesn’t appear until nearly the end of the song, a rare structure in mainstream music.
  • “Don’t Stop Believin'” holds the record as the best-selling digital track from the 20th century.
